d.
Test LOCAL/REMOTE Switch (S6).
1.
Unsolder wire no. 52 at switch.
Connect VOM + lead to switch (S6) center terminal and - lead to switch
2.
(S6) lower terminal.
With switch toggle in down position, the VOM should read infinite ohms.
3.
With switch toggle in up position, the VOM should read zero ohms.
4.
Disconnect VOM and resolder wire no. 52 to lower terminal of switch
(S6).
